Melville Rail Station Heritage Association The final step in the years-long process to have Melville’s historic rail station designated a National Historic Site has been completed. Last week, Motherwell Homestead staffers -- interpretation co-ordinator Sheldon Matsalla and asset manager Shayne Stoll -- installed the 27 x 30-inch, 100-pound bronze plaque near the station’s main entrance.
